A slow computer is most commonly caused by one of three issues: a nearly full hard drive, too many programs launching automatically at startup, or an aging hard drive beginning to fail. In most cases, a slow computer does not need to be replaced — a diagnostic and tune-up resolves the problem. Replacing a traditional hard drive with a solid-state drive (SSD) is one of the most effective and affordable upgrades, often restoring near-new performance for $100–$200 in parts and labor.
If the repair costs less than 50% of a comparable new machine, repair is almost always the better value. A laptop that feels slow or won't charge often needs only a new SSD or battery — repairs that typically run $75–$200 and can add years of useful life. Exceptions include machines over 7–8 years old, those with motherboard failure, or cases where the cost of repairs exceeds the value of the device.

A business relying solely on Windows Defender and no formal backup strategy is not adequately protected. Effective protection requires a layered approach: endpoint detection software beyond built-in antivirus, automated offsite backups that are tested regularly, DNS filtering to block malicious sites, and employee awareness of phishing threats. If you cannot answer yes to all four of those, your business has gaps that ransomware attackers actively exploit.

In many cases, yes. Data recovery is possible when files have been accidentally deleted, a hard drive has failed, or a system won't boot. Success rates depend on the type of failure — logical failures such as accidental deletion or corruption have higher recovery rates than physical drive failures. Recovery is attempted before any repairs that could overwrite existing data.
Break/fix IT support means you call a technician when something goes wrong and pay per incident. Managed IT services means a technician proactively monitors and maintains your systems for a flat monthly fee, preventing most problems before they cause downtime. Break/fix works well for simple one-time repairs; managed services are better suited for small businesses that depend on their technology daily and cannot afford unexpected outages.
